The Fix is In?


Beer and wine will be sold at the failing Five Stuy Cafe. At least that is my prediction. When and if it gets official, I will repost a link to my previous main page post on "Let the Beer Flow." Because that is where we have heading.

The current Management will pull a fast one by having a "Town Hall" meeting (of course, at the small Community Center) on April 3rd. Residents will hear the reasons for the application from Five Stuy Cafe. Already posted online is the FAQ, which state that Stuyvesant Property Services (basically Manager Rick Hayduk, with Blackstone behind him) are for Five Stuy Cafe to sell beer and wine.

Of course, Stuy Town has been known as a family community for decades, and even is trying to sell that notion to prospective residents. But people know the truth. Money and more money is vastly important to the landlord (Blackstone now), and Rick Hayduk was chosen, for a variety of reasons, to make the huge pill go down.

This is what I see at Five Star Cafe. It has never followed the rule of "For Resident and their Guests," though now they were assuredly do. Five Star Cafe been a commercial space open to all, which is against zoning regulations.... Five Star Cafe may even purposefully wait for this meeting, and then thank us for bringing up the subject, all the while internally smiling that they have given in to residents. This is a ploy. Nothing more.

There are over 21 thousands residents of Stuy Town. Officially. How many go to the cafe? If you look at the number, not many. But FAQ states that cafe is popular and used by residents. BS.

We are told that the staff at Five Stuy Cafe will be trained for this new beer and wine use. Yes, trained enough to spot fake age IDs.

Five Stuy Cafe needs the money. Most people like to sit, buy something and smooch. The college set like to take out their laptops and work. They will buy something, but is it enough to keep the cafe going?

There are other rules that the cafe will try to explain way. How about the 500 foot rule that disallows the selling of beer and wine so close to certain establishments? Are playgrounds with children part of this? How about the potential of increasing noise from the cafe?

And please don't rely on Public Safety. We know their success at enforcing the troublesome rules that get continually mentioned by Management.

Wednesday, April 3th, starting at 6:30 PM. A meeting with Five Stuy Cafe. Management might be there, too.
